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 2/7] iommu/mediatek: Rename the register STANDARD_AXI_MODE(0x48) to MISC_CTRL
Date: Mon, 25 May 2020 14:11:26 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1590387086.13912.4.camel@mhfsdcap03>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200509083654.5178-3-chao.hao@mediatek.com>
On Sat, 2020-05-09 at 16:36 +0800, Chao Hao wrote:
> For iommu offset=0x48 register, only the previous mt8173/mt8183 use the
> name STANDARD_AXI_MODE, all the latest SoC extend the register more
> feature by different bits, for example: axi_mode, in_order_en, coherent_en
> and so on. So rename REG_MMU_MISC_CTRL may be more proper.
>
> This patch only rename the register name, no functional change.
